High Temperature Sinter HIP Furnace With Fast Cooling Tungsten Overview Sinter HIP furnaces with fast cooling are designed to integrate the
functions of pressure partial pressure sintering, pressure sintering, atmosphere
sintering, de-waxing, vacuum de-waxing, vacuum sintering, fast cooling
and etc. Feature 1. Stable performance 2. High density of product 3. Rapid cooling 4. Only 30 minutes is needed to cool down the furnace from 1450°C to
150°C. 5. Automatic control during whole process Technical specifications Model | GN3312F-1 | GN5518F-1 | Operating life | 6000 Furnace run (about 20 years) | Dimension of usable space | 300×300×1200mm | 500×500×1800mm | Max. load weight | 500KG | 1500KG | Power | 320kW | 420 kW | Max. pressure | 1MPa | Max. working pressure | 0.98MPa | Max. working temperature | 1550°C | Temperature control method | 3 zones | High temperature uniformity | ≤±7°C (Ceramic rings) | Paraffin as the binder | Hc deviation | ≤±0.3KA/M | Com deviation | ≤±0.2% | Temperature increasing rate (without loading) | 10°C/min(≤1200°C); 8°C/min(1200-1520°C); | Ultimate vacuum | ≤ 2Pa, tested in cold and clean chamber | Vacuum leak rate | ≤ 2Pa/h, tested in cold and clean chamber | Pumping speed | ≤20 min., pumping to 3Pa in cold and clean chamber | Wax collecting rate | ≥98﹪ (Paraffin as the binder) | Fast cooling(with loading) (cooling water ≤30°C) | From 1450 °C to 100°C, 30 minutes | From 1450 °C to 100°C, 40 minutes | Temperature measuring | W-Re 5-26 double-core thermocouple | Allowed process gases | Ar, H2, N2, CH4 |
